Counseling Services

Our Process 

Talk therapy can be a beneficial process in which you may develop a clearer understanding of yourself, values, and goals. Our counseling approach uses strength based interventions that are best suited for each individual person.  We believe people are the experts in their own lives, responsible for their behaviors, and are responding to circumstances beyond their control.

The counseling relationship assists people in exploring and incorporating coping strategies for difficult life issues. 

We’re dedicated to providing not just the tools for healing, but the compassionate support that makes all the difference. We’re here to meet you where you are, with empathy and care every step of the way.

Intern Program

Our office strives to further the counseling profession and provide opportunities to Master and Doctoral level interns to obtain their clinical experience and quality support and supervision. Interns offer many options for services including: individual, couples, and group sessions. Co-therapy, with an intern and licensed counselor can also provide emerging therapists and clients with two perspectives in the therapeutic process.   

Interns are in graduate level programs and are typically with us for 1-2 semesters (6 months-1 year). Liz Daniels, MA. LPCC and Andres Duran, MA. LPCC are licensed professional counselors, who provide individual and group supervision for interns. 
  

Session Details & Fees

Therapy is an investment in you and in your well-being. We often spend a lot of time in life focusing on external things like work, friends, family, money, everything else, but this is the time and place for you to focus on YOU.

SESSION TIMES:
Sessions are typically 45-55 minutes long. Most clients come once per week, but we can discuss what is best for you in the first session.
​
FEES:
Generally fees range from $125-$180/session
Fees/Co-pays are due at the time of service in the form of cash, check, or debit/credit card. At times, we may have reduced rate spots available.

Internship program fees: $40/session

Telehealth Video Sessions


Distance counseling can easily be done by either phone or video. In our experience, most people find it to be an easy transition, and we will do our best to help with the transition.

Video sessions are conducted through Simple Practice, a secure video platform, and a meeting request will come to you via email
